Senior Front-End Developer Utah
Company: Overstock.com, Inc.
Location: Midvale
Posted on: September 17, 2023
|
|
Job Description:
Senior Front-End Developer (Overstock.com, Inc., Midvale,
UT)
Work with developers, designers and product managers to implement
features for company website and other internal applications.
Identify and resolve standards in performance, usability and
accessibility. Perform site optimization and update internal
documentation, acting as a liaison between business, UX and
Site-Reliability Engineering. Assist and educate junior Front-End
Developers on best practices of front-end development. Collaborate
with development and QA teams to code HTML/CSS/JavaScript
interfaces, test, and verify projects through deployment process.
Oversee site optimization for Search Engine Optimization, cleaner
and concise code, and code weight. Update internal documentation
when new tools are available for developers to use and distribute
the information to developers and their managers. Build out
templates using ReactJS for new features and layouts. Optimize code
for clean, performant and accessible functionality. Create reusable
HTML, CSS & JavaScript modules. Oversee deployment of production
code. Set up A/B Tests for new features. Perform other duties as
required and assigned by manager and upper management. Follow legal
policies as directed. Position allows telecommuting from anywhere
in the U.S. Salary: $135,803 - $156,000 per year.
Minimum Requirements: Bachelor's degree or U.S. equivalent in
Computer Applications, Computer Engineering, Computer Science,
Information Systems, Information Technology, or related field plus
5 years of professional experience performing front-end application
development (including requirement gathering and analysis,
planning, development, implementation, and maintenance), website
coding, and using front-end technologies (including CSS, HTML, and
JavaScript) to engage in the full development life cycle.
In lieu of Bachelor's degree plus 5 years of experience, the
employer will also accept a Master's degree or U.S. equivalent in
Computer Applications, Computer Engineering, Computer Science,
Information Systems, Information Technology, or related field plus
3 years of professional experience performing front-end application
development (including requirement gathering and analysis,
planning, development, implementation, and maintenance), website
coding, and using front-end technologies (including CSS, HTML, and
JavaScript) to engage in the full development life cycle.
Must also have the following: 3 years of professional experience
building custom and reusable JavaScript components and modules; 3
years of professional experience using JavaScript and programming
concepts (including: NPM scripts, Webpack, or Babel) and using
backend languages (including: Java, C#, Python, PHP, or Ruby); 3
years of professional experience utilizing Front End Build
Processes and Package Management; and 3 years of professional
experience performing Unit Test creation and implementation,
debugging and bug fixes, version control, deployment, Backend API
Integration, A/B Test setup, and Browser Performance and
Compatibility.
Please submit resume online at: www.overstock.com/careers or via
email: overstockcareers@overstock.com. Please specify ad code
AESJH.
Keywords: Overstock.com, Inc., Salt Lake City , Senior Front-End Developer Utah, IT / Software / Systems , Midvale, Utah
Click
here to apply!
|